What Features Should You Look for in Socks for Women’s Cowboy Boots?

When selecting socks for women’s cowboy boots, several key features ensure comfort, style, and functionality. Consider the following factors:

  • Material: Look for socks made from breathable fabrics such as cotton, wool, or moisture-wicking blends. These materials help keep feet dry and comfortable, especially during long wear.

  • Thickness: Choose the thickness based on the fit of your cowboy boots. Thicker socks provide extra cushioning, while thinner options may offer a snugger fit. Ensure the socks don’t cause your boots to fit too tightly.

  • Height: Opt for crew-length or knee-high socks that prevent chafing against the boot collar and offer additional warmth in colder climates. The right height also enhances the overall aesthetic when paired with cowboy boots.

  • Arch Support: Socks with built-in arch support help alleviate fatigue, particularly during extended wear. This feature is essential for those who spend long hours on their feet.

  • Design & Color: Choose styles that match your personality or outfits. Fun patterns and colors can add a trendy touch to your cowboy boot ensemble.

Selecting socks with these characteristics can enhance both your comfort and overall style while wearing women’s cowboy boots.

What Materials are Best for Comfort and Durability in Cowboy Boot Socks?

The best materials for comfort and durability in women’s cowboy boot socks include:

  • Merino Wool: This natural fiber is known for its softness and moisture-wicking properties, making it ideal for all-day wear. Merino wool regulates temperature, keeping feet warm in cold weather and cool in warm weather, while also resisting odors.
  • Cotton Blend: Cotton socks are breathable and soft, providing a comfortable fit inside cowboy boots. Blending cotton with synthetic fibers like nylon or spandex enhances durability and elasticity, ensuring the socks maintain their shape and withstand wear and tear.
  • Polyester: As a synthetic material, polyester offers excellent durability and moisture management. It dries quickly and resists shrinking and fading, making it a practical choice for active individuals who need reliable socks for long hours in cowboy boots.
  • Bamboo: Bamboo socks are incredibly soft and have natural antibacterial properties, which help in reducing foot odor. They also provide good moisture-wicking abilities, keeping feet dry and comfortable, which is particularly important when wearing boots for extended periods.
  • Spandex: While not a standalone material, spandex is often blended with other fibers to provide stretch and a snug fit. This elasticity ensures that the socks stay up without slipping down into the boot, enhancing comfort during wear.

Why is Breathability Crucial for Socks Worn with Cowboy Boots?

Breathability is crucial for socks worn with cowboy boots primarily because it helps regulate temperature and moisture, preventing discomfort and blisters during extended wear.

According to a study published in the Journal of Foot and Ankle Research, materials that allow for airflow significantly reduce the risk of overheating and moisture buildup, which can lead to skin irritation and fungal infections. This is particularly important in the context of cowboy boots, which are often made of leather and can be less ventilated than other types of footwear.

The underlying mechanism involves the interaction between body heat, sweat production, and the material properties of the socks. When moisture accumulates in socks that lack breathability, it creates a damp environment that not only clings to the skin but also promotes friction against the boot’s interior. This friction can lead to blisters and discomfort, as noted by the American Podiatric Medical Association. Therefore, choosing socks made from breathable materials like merino wool or synthetic blends can enhance comfort and foot health while wearing cowboy boots.

What Length of Socks is Most Suitable for Women’s Cowboy Boots?

The most suitable lengths of socks for women’s cowboy boots vary based on style, comfort, and intended use.

  • Crew Socks: Crew socks typically reach up to the mid-calf, making them a popular choice for cowboy boots as they provide ample coverage and prevent chafing from the boot’s shaft.
  • Over-the-Calf Socks: These socks extend above the calf, offering additional warmth and support, which is especially beneficial for colder climates or long periods of wear.
  • Ankle Socks: Ankle socks sit just above the ankle and are suitable for those who prefer a lower profile, though they may not provide the same level of protection from boot friction.
  • Boot Socks: Specifically designed for wearing with boots, these socks often feature extra cushioning in the heel and toe, enhancing comfort during extended wear and helping absorb impact.

Crew socks are favored for their balance between comfort and coverage, ensuring that the boot does not rub against the skin while still allowing for breathability. Over-the-calf socks are ideal if you’re looking for warmth and extra support, making them perfect for outdoor activities in colder weather.

Ankle socks are a lighter option, providing minimal coverage and ideal for casual wear, though they lack the protective features needed for long-term use with taller boots. Boot socks combine various features, such as cushioning and moisture-wicking properties, making them an excellent choice for those who spend long hours on their feet in cowboy boots.

How Can You Extend the Lifespan of Your Cowboy Boot Socks?

  • Choose High-Quality Materials: Opt for socks made from durable fibers such as merino wool, cotton blends, or synthetic materials designed for moisture-wicking. These materials provide comfort and breathability while resisting wear and tear.
  • Wash with Care: Always follow the washing instructions on the label, using cold water and mild detergent. Avoid bleach and fabric softeners, as these can degrade the fibers and elasticity of the socks.
  • Avoid Overuse: Rotate your socks regularly to prevent excessive wear on a single pair. This practice allows the fibers to recover and prolongs the life of each pair.
  • Store Properly: When not in use, store your socks in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Avoid stuffing them into tight spaces which can cause creases and damage the elastic.
  • Repair Instead of Replace: If you notice small holes or wear spots, consider mending them instead of discarding the socks. Hand-stitching or using a repair patch can extend their usability and save money in the long run.
